Grasping Hands of Horror
(Necromancy)

Range:  10 yards per level
Components:  V, S
Duration:  Instantaneous
Casting Time:  1
Area of Effect:  One arm per level
Saving Throw:  Negates

This spell causes a number of arms equal to the level of the wizard to reach out of the ground and grab at the target. The hands themselves do no damage, but when they pull a victim under, that victim begins to suffocate.
Victims have to make a saving throw every round they are in the area of effect and for every extra hand they have a -1 on their saving throw. In a graveyard or similar corpse-infested area there is an additional -2 to the saving throw. If a victim fails its saving throw, it is dragged underground and starts to suffocate. Others can dig the victim out, mundanely or magically. He will be found two feet or so under the ground, paralysed, but quite aware of what happened. A really high-level wizard could cast this spell and affect many people by giving five arms to this target, four to that one, and so on.
